Archives 2.0 is not a passing fad, just adding web 2.0 to archives, or something only for the future or tech-savvy people. Archives 2.0 is a natural evolution from Archives 1.0, moving from closed and archivist-centered practices to being more open, transparent, user-centered, and using technology and standards. It focuses on measuring outcomes and impacts, and sees archivists as facilitators valued for what they do, rather than authorities valued for what they know.
